A project by  Quynh Vantu

Quynh Vantu is a licensed architect and artist from the United States with a studio-based practice devoted to spatial experimentation. Drawing from her upbringing in the “American South”, Vantu is particularly interested in the notion of hospitality and thresholds of social interaction. Working in situ she creates her works across cultural boundaries and employs an interdisciplinary practice utilizing architecture as a foundation.

She received her Master of Architecture (2009) from Cranbrook Academy of Art in the USA and her Bachelor or Architecture (2001) from Virginia Polytechnic Institute and State University in the USA. She has been awarded numerous grants and awards both nationally and internationally, including a Worldstudio AIGA Grant (2009); the Stewardson Kefee LeBrun Travel Grant-AIA NY (2009–10); and a grant from the Graham Foundation for Advanced Studies in the Fine Arts (2016). She has been awarded several artist residencies, including at the Bemis Center for Contemporary Arts in Omaha, Nebraska (2010); the Skowhegan School of Painting and Sculpture in Skowhegan, Maine (2012); the McColl Center for Art and Innovation in Charlotte, North Carolina (2014); Kamiyama AIR in Kamiyama, Japan (2015); and Nanji – Seoul Museum of Art in Seoul, South Korea (2016). She was the recipient of a DAAD Stipendium to study at Olafur Eliasson’s Institut für Raumexperimente in Berlin, Germany (2010–11); a Fulbright Fellowship to study in the UK (2012–13); a University College London Scholarship to pursue a Ph.D. at the Bartlett School of Architecture (2014-2018); a finalist for the Harvard Graduate School of Design’s Wheelwright Prize (2015); and named a fellow for the US-Japan Friendship Commission’s Creative Artists Program (2017).
